CHETAS HOSPITAL

Complete details including address, contact info, and facilities in Udaipur, Rajasthan

CHETAS HOSPITAL

Address: 10-a, Road Number 5 Opposite Sachin Motors, Behind Saheli Palace, Near Commissioner Office, Panchwati, Udaipur, Rajasthan

City: Udaipur

State: Rajasthan

Pincode: 313004